This review is from: 52" Casa Vieja Outdoor Mission™ Damp Listed Fan I found this fan easy to install, and we think it looks great in our sunroom. Because I was installing on a sloped ceiling, I had to head to Lowes to purchase a longer downrod. Because the fan comes setup for a 1/2" downrod, I also had to purchase a 3/4 to 1/2 conversion kit. This is all readily available. With the new downrod and converter, I had no problem setting up the fan to run off of two light switches, one for the light and one for the fan with the shared neutral. My only minor gripes are: 1. The two screws used to tighten the downrod into the fan housing. There should be three. If you tighten the two, the rod almost automatically wants to slant slighting coming out of the fan housing. I still need to rebalance things. 2. The blades are plastic. This is fine because I want it to last outdoors. However, they could have at least varied the appearance of the wood grain so that it doesn't LOOK so plastic/fake. 3.
